Re: Rave?

Yeah that was annoying. They gathered everyone together at one end of the dome to watch the Einstein finals. Then they wanted everyone to get up and move and find new seats at the other end of the dome for the closing ceremonies. They should have announced Chairman's at the end of the Einstein finals, then moved everyone over for the concert.

Of course I understand the logistics of this was to set up one stage while still using another - but did they have any idea how long it takes to get 20,000 people to move through the arena, shuffling through the narrow aisles, all at the same time? That's not even counting the matter of grabbing food in between.
